If you are developing an online or hybrid course, revising a course, or looking to enhance your course design regardless of modality, TLDE can provide instructional design support. From designing individual lessons, learning materials, or activities to full course revisions, the instructional designer is your creative partner.
We can help with:
- Incorporating new instructional technologies or techniques
- Adapting existing course materials into new modalities
- Creating innovative, engaging learning activities
- Improving accessibility of digital content
- Designing inclusive, equitable learning and learning environments
TLDE staff are experts in Quality Matters, the framework that informs the GRCC distance learning standards. We use the standards to review and approve all online and hybrid courses offered by the college.
